What Is a Dog Bite Claim?

A dog bite claim is a personal injury case brought by someone who was injured by a dog due to the owner’s failure to control or restrain the animal. These claims may arise from bites, knocks, scratches, or attacks that cause physical injury or emotional trauma. Dog bite claims can involve homeowners’ insurance policies, renters’ insurance, or, in some cases, direct claims against the dog owner.

Common dog bite injuries include puncture wounds, nerve damage, broken bones, infections, facial injuries, and psychological trauma—especially in children. Even bites that initially seem minor can lead to serious complications if left untreated.

Missouri Dog Bite Law

Missouri has one of the most victim-friendly dog bite laws in the country. Under Missouri Revised Statutes § 273.036, dog owners are held strictly liable for injuries caused by their dogs.

This means that, in most cases, you do not have to prove that the dog owner was negligent or that the dog had previously bitten someone. To recover compensation, you generally must show that:

  • The defendant owned the dog
  • The dog bit or injured you
  • You were lawfully on public or private property at the time of the attack
  • You did not provoke the dog

Because Missouri follows strict liability, dog owners cannot avoid responsibility simply by claiming they did not know the dog was dangerous. Common Causes of Dog Bite Injuries

Dog attacks often occur because owners fail to take proper precautions. Common contributing factors include:

  • Dogs not kept on a leash in public places
  • Inadequate fencing or broken gates
  • Failure to restrain dogs around children or visitors
  • Poor training or socialization
  • Ignoring local leash laws or animal control regulations

Dog bites frequently occur in neighborhoods, apartment complexes, parks, sidewalks, and even inside the victim’s own home while visiting a friend or family member.

Who Can Be Held Liable for a Dog Bite?

In most cases, the dog’s owner is legally responsible for injuries caused by their dog. However, depending on the circumstances, other parties may also be liable, such as:

  • Landlords who allow dangerous dogs on their property
  • Property owners who knew about aggressive animals on the premises
  • Dog sitters or caretakers responsible for the animal at the time of the attack

Recovering Compensation After a Dog Bite in MO

A serious dog bite can result in significant financial and emotional losses. A Columbia dog bite attorney can help you pursue compensation for both economic and non-economic damages, including:

  • Emergency room visits and hospitalization
  • Surgery, stitches, and follow-up care
  • Physical therapy and rehabilitation
  • Prescription medications
  • Future medical treatment
  • Scarring and disfigurement
  • Pain and suffering
  • Emotional distress and anxiety
  • Lost wages and reduced earning capacity

In cases involving children, compensation may also account for long-term psychological trauma and future medical needs related to scarring or reconstructive surgery.

Dog Bite Claim FAQs

How long do I have to file a dog bite claim in Missouri?

Missouri’s stat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ally five years from the date of the injury. However, it’s best to act quickly while evidence and witness memories are still fresh.

What if the dog owner is a friend or family member?

Many dog bite claims are paid through homeowners’ or renters’ insurance, not out of the owner’s personal pocket. Filing a claim may not directly harm your relationship.

What if I was bitten on someone else’s property?

You may still have a valid claim under Missouri’s strict liability law, as long as you were lawfully on the property and did not provoke the dog.

What should I do immediately after a dog bite?

  • Seek medical attention right away.
  • Report the incident to local authorities or animal control.
  • Take photos of your injuries and the location of the attack.
  • Gather contact information for the dog’s owner and any witnesses.
